Intestinal microbiota of Atlantic salmon freshwater parr and seawater post-smolts. Atlantic salmon gut metagenome

Atlantic salmon undergo dramatic physiological changes as they migrate from freshwater to the marine environment. Osmoregulatory adaptation is the most crucial change, necessitating functional adaptations of the gills, kidney and intestine. Additionally, novel pathogens, microbes and dietary items are encountered in the saltwater environment, which suggests major changes in the intestinal microbiota following movement to saltwater.This study compared the intestinal microbiota harboured in the distal digesta of Atlantic salmon freshwater fish kept in a commercial Scottish freshwater hatchery with that of their full-siblings after seawater acclimatisation by a 16S rRNA targeted high throughput sequencing approach. The results will help to enhance our understanding of how physiological changes within the host parallel to habitat change can affect the microbial community harboured in the intestine.
